cvs commit: src/gnu/usr.bin/groff/tmac mdoc.local src/lib Makefile src/lib/libkiconv Makefile kiconv.3 quirks.c quirks.h xlat16_iconv.c xlat16_sysctl.c src/release/i386 fixit_crunch.conf src/release/ia64 boot_crunch.conf src/release/pc98 ...

Max Khon fjoe at FreeBSD.org
Fri Sep 26 13:26:27 PDT 2003


fjoe        2003/09/26 13:26:25 PDT

  FreeBSD src repository

  Modified files:
    gnu/usr.bin/groff/tmac mdoc.local 
    lib                  Makefile 
    release/i386         fixit_crunch.conf 
    release/ia64         boot_crunch.conf 
    release/pc98         fixit-small_crunch.conf fixit_crunch.conf 
    rescue/rescue        Makefile 
    sbin/mount_cd9660    Makefile mount_cd9660.8 mount_cd9660.c 
    sbin/mount_msdosfs   Makefile mount_msdosfs.8 mount_msdosfs.c 
    sbin/mount_ntfs      Makefile mount_ntfs.8 mount_ntfs.c 
    share/mk             bsd.libnames.mk 
    sys/conf             NOTES files options 
    sys/fs/msdosfs       direntry.h msdosfs_conv.c 
                         msdosfs_lookup.c msdosfs_vfsops.c 
                         msdosfs_vnops.c msdosfsmount.h 
    sys/fs/ntfs          ntfs.h ntfs_subr.c ntfs_subr.h 
                         ntfs_vfsops.c ntfs_vnops.c ntfsmount.h 
    sys/fs/smbfs         smbfs_vfsops.c 
    sys/isofs/cd9660     cd9660_lookup.c cd9660_mount.h 
                         cd9660_rrip.c cd9660_util.c 
                         cd9660_vfsops.c cd9660_vnops.c iso.h 
    sys/libkern          iconv.c iconv_converter_if.m iconv_xlat.c 
    sys/modules          Makefile 
    sys/modules/cd9660   Makefile 
    sys/modules/libiconv Makefile 
    sys/modules/msdosfs  Makefile 
    sys/modules/ntfs     Makefile 
    sys/netsmb           smb_dev.c 
    sys/sys              iconv.h 
  Added files:
    lib/libkiconv        Makefile kiconv.3 quirks.c quirks.h 
                         xlat16_iconv.c xlat16_sysctl.c 
    sys/fs/msdosfs       msdosfs_iconv.c 
    sys/fs/ntfs          ntfs_iconv.c 
    sys/isofs/cd9660     cd9660_iconv.c 
    sys/libkern          iconv_xlat16.c 
    sys/modules/cd9660_iconv Makefile 
    sys/modules/msdosfs_iconv Makefile 
    sys/modules/ntfs_iconv Makefile 
  Removed files:
    sbin/mount_msdosfs   iso22dos iso72dos koi2dos koi8u2dos 
  Log:
  - Support for multibyte charsets in LIBICONV.
  - CD9660_ICONV, NTFS_ICONV and MSDOSFS_ICONV kernel options
  (with corresponding modules).
  - kiconv(3) for loadable charset conversion tables support.
  
  Submitted by:   Ryuichiro Imura <imura at ryu16.org>
  
  Revision  Changes    Path
  1.31      +1 -0      src/gnu/usr.bin/groff/tmac/mdoc.local
  1.172     +1 -1      src/lib/Makefile
  1.1       +17 -0     src/lib/libkiconv/Makefile (new)
  1.1       +106 -0    src/lib/libkiconv/kiconv.3 (new)
  1.1       +192 -0    src/lib/libkiconv/quirks.c (new)
  1.1       +45 -0     src/lib/libkiconv/quirks.h (new)
  1.1       +374 -0    src/lib/libkiconv/xlat16_iconv.c (new)
  1.1       +81 -0     src/lib/libkiconv/xlat16_sysctl.c (new)
  1.11      +1 -1      src/release/i386/fixit_crunch.conf
  1.5       +1 -1      src/release/ia64/boot_crunch.conf
  1.4       +1 -1      src/release/pc98/fixit-small_crunch.conf
  1.11      +1 -1      src/release/pc98/fixit_crunch.conf
  1.18      +1 -1      src/rescue/rescue/Makefile
  1.8       +6 -0      src/sbin/mount_cd9660/Makefile
  1.22      +9 -0      src/sbin/mount_cd9660/mount_cd9660.8
  1.22      +40 -2     src/sbin/mount_cd9660/mount_cd9660.c
  1.24      +6 -10     src/sbin/mount_msdosfs/Makefile
  1.2       +0 -58     src/sbin/mount_msdosfs/iso22dos (dead)
  1.3       +0 -60     src/sbin/mount_msdosfs/iso72dos (dead)
  1.3       +0 -58     src/sbin/mount_msdosfs/koi2dos (dead)
  1.2       +0 -60     src/sbin/mount_msdosfs/koi8u2dos (dead)
  1.28      +26 -33    src/sbin/mount_msdosfs/mount_msdosfs.8
  1.26      +110 -88   src/sbin/mount_msdosfs/mount_msdosfs.c
  1.8       +6 -2      src/sbin/mount_ntfs/Makefile
  1.19      +22 -0     src/sbin/mount_ntfs/mount_ntfs.8
  1.9       +76 -70    src/sbin/mount_ntfs/mount_ntfs.c
  1.70      +1 -0      src/share/mk/bsd.libnames.mk
  1.1178    +6 -0      src/sys/conf/NOTES
  1.826     +4 -0      src/sys/conf/files
  1.415     +5 -0      src/sys/conf/options
  1.17      +14 -6     src/sys/fs/msdosfs/direntry.h
  1.34      +482 -289  src/sys/fs/msdosfs/msdosfs_conv.c
  1.1       +36 -0     src/sys/fs/msdosfs/msdosfs_iconv.c (new)
  1.39      +20 -23    src/sys/fs/msdosfs/msdosfs_lookup.c
  1.106     +25 -9     src/sys/fs/msdosfs/msdosfs_vfsops.c
  1.141     +10 -11    src/sys/fs/msdosfs/msdosfs_vnops.c
  1.29      +9 -13     src/sys/fs/msdosfs/msdosfsmount.h
  1.15      +2 -0      src/sys/fs/ntfs/ntfs.h
  1.1       +36 -0     src/sys/fs/ntfs/ntfs_iconv.c (new)
  1.32      +135 -31   src/sys/fs/ntfs/ntfs_subr.c
  1.13      +5 -4      src/sys/fs/ntfs/ntfs_subr.h
  1.57      +7 -6      src/sys/fs/ntfs/ntfs_vfsops.c
  1.40      +9 -5      src/sys/fs/ntfs/ntfs_vnops.c
  1.8       +4 -3      src/sys/fs/ntfs/ntfsmount.h
  1.21      +1 -1      src/sys/fs/smbfs/smbfs_vfsops.c
  1.1       +36 -0     src/sys/isofs/cd9660/cd9660_iconv.c (new)
  1.37      +6 -1      src/sys/isofs/cd9660/cd9660_lookup.c
  1.6       +4 -1      src/sys/isofs/cd9660/cd9660_mount.h
  1.25      +7 -5      src/sys/isofs/cd9660/cd9660_rrip.c
  1.21      +106 -49   src/sys/isofs/cd9660/cd9660_util.c
  1.114     +19 -1     src/sys/isofs/cd9660/cd9660_vfsops.c
  1.92      +3 -1      src/sys/isofs/cd9660/cd9660_vnops.c
  1.25      +7 -3      src/sys/isofs/cd9660/iso.h
  1.7       +50 -5     src/sys/libkern/iconv.c
  1.2       +2 -0      src/sys/libkern/iconv_converter_if.m
  1.5       +10 -4     src/sys/libkern/iconv_xlat.c
  1.1       +242 -0    src/sys/libkern/iconv_xlat16.c (new)
  1.351     +3 -0      src/sys/modules/Makefile
  1.15      +1 -1      src/sys/modules/cd9660/Makefile
  1.1       +7 -0      src/sys/modules/cd9660_iconv/Makefile (new)
  1.4       +6 -2      src/sys/modules/libiconv/Makefile
  1.20      +1 -0      src/sys/modules/msdosfs/Makefile
  1.1       +7 -0      src/sys/modules/msdosfs_iconv/Makefile (new)
  1.11      +1 -0      src/sys/modules/ntfs/Makefile
  1.1       +7 -0      src/sys/modules/ntfs_iconv/Makefile (new)
  1.19      +1 -1      src/sys/netsmb/smb_dev.c
  1.6       +86 -1     src/sys/sys/iconv.h


More information about the cvs-src mailing list